Output 42eba43608e74b293061594408347e233e47543217901300ad4be1dc41c17823:6

value
24999750000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c705cca3bb1ebdba45ad6fe2d90f6a6264c10377 OP_EQUALVERIFY OP_CHECKSIG
address
DPHRxP1JTeSPu7Yh2RpJdUBN2oyQUzyDXP
transaction
42eba43608e74b293061594408347e233e47543217901300ad4be1dc41c17823